According to reports, Michael was “living in fear” of the past happening again following the two suicides on his mother’s side of the family. In 1964, Uncle Colin, who was thought to be secretly gay, was discovered dead at the age of 38 from an overdose. Then, Michael claims that his maternal grandpa George James Harrison, who was 66 at the time, is likewise thought to have committed himself in 1960.

This goes against the late pop star’s 2007 version of events, in which he claimed that his mother Lesley discovered them “gassed to death” in 1963 within a few days of one another. Michael created a song called My Mother Had A Brother about his uncle, who he said would inherit his schizophrenia. He was “haunted” and “fixated” on his uncle’s death. 

Similar to his uncle, Michael tried to hide his sexual orientation from his early years. Later, the pop sensation claimed that his uncle committed himself because he was unable to handle keeping his homosexuality a secret. Michael claimed that although the loss of his Uncle Colin had a profound impact on him, his first depressive episode occurred in 1993 after the AIDS-related death of his girlfriend, Anselmo Feleppa. If Anselmo hadn’t passed away, Michael’s longtime buddy Andros Georgiou thinks he would still be alive.

“George was the love of his life and if he hadn’t died I think George would still be here,” he stated to The Mirror. Following Anselmo, he failed to discover true love. I could see their joy. After Anselmo passed away, I believe he was completely lost; it was a shock.” Then, when Lesley Angold Panayiotou, George’s mother, passed away at the age of 60 from cancer in 1997, George was crushed. The late singer fell into a profound despair after her passing. 

He previously stated to The Guardian, “If I had come close to saying I don’t want to live, that would have been after my Mum died.” “I was overcome with the sense that my finest days were behind me. I adored and admired my mother dearly.”

Michael also stated that his mother did not inform him about his uncle’s cause of death until he was sixteen years old. “It changed my opinion of her entirely because it wasn’t just that; she also witnessed the death of her father in the same manner,” he continued. Each of them had buried their heads in the gas oven. And the good old mum discovered them both.

“The world was shocked to learn that Michael had died unexpectedly at the age of 53 on December 25, 2016. When Fadi Fawaz, his boyfriend, went to wake him up in the morning at their Oxfordshire house in Goring-on-the-Thames, Michael was dead in bed. Fadi made the following declaration in a statement: “Our plan was to go to Christmas lunch. When I walked around to rouse him up, he was gone, resting in bed contentedly.”We’re still unsure of what transpired. Even though things had been somewhat challenging lately, I and George were both looking forward to Christmas.” Later on, he tweeted: “It’s Christmas, and I will never forget waking up to discover your lover dead in bed quietly… I shall always miss you, xx.”
